Forskningsstipendium

Stiftelsen för Njursjuka

Stiftelsen för Njursjuka (Foundation for Kidney Patients) awards research grants to researchers working with patient-centered research on kidney failure and kidney donations. The research concerns patients with chronic advanced kidney failure or who are kidney transplant recipients and can be conducted at universities, colleges or other public institutions in Sweden. Research projects can be of a clinical, medical or psychosocial nature. The foundation distributed a total of 500,000 SEK in research grants in 2024. The amount can be awarded to a single project or distributed among several projects, based on the board's assessment.

Till Nanna Svartz minne

Reumatikerförbundet

The Nanna Svartz Memorial Scholarship is a joint award from Reumatikerförbundet (Swedish Rheumatism Association) and Pfizer, honoring Sweden's first female professor of medicine, Nanna Svartz. The scholarship aims to encourage patient-centered research in Sweden and contribute to increased interest and awareness of rheumatological research among healthcare personnel, decision-makers, and the general public. The award recognizes both senior and early-career researchers who remain research-active with strong research merits. The scholarship of 150,000 SEK can be used for research or related activities such as education or study trips. Great weight is placed on the quality of the nomination and motivation, and previous nominations are not a barrier to being considered. The award is typically presented during Reumadagarna (Rheumatology Days), though the 2025 ceremony will take place at a different event in November.

Forskningsanslag

Radiumhemmets Forskningsfonder

Radiumhemmets Forskningsfonder finances clinical patient-centered cancer research for improved diagnostics and more effective individualized cancer treatment. The foundation supports clinical patient-centered cancer research and translational research within Region Stockholm. To be eligible for a grant, the research project must have a clear connection to clinical cancer treatment or cancer diagnostics with direct patient connection or clear translational research focus. Applications from younger researchers are encouraged. The selection of research focus is based on the fact that basic and preclinical research has several other sources of funding, while patient-centered research has more difficulty obtaining financial support.

Neuroförbundet Research Grant

Neuroförbundet

Neuroförbundet offers research grants for studies focusing on neurological disorders through the Neurofonden foundation. The grants support scientific research into causes and treatments of organic neurological diseases, with priority given to clinical research and practical applications addressing functional disability needs. The foundation primarily supports younger researchers conducting clinically adapted, patient-centered research that directly benefits members. Both small and large projects receive funding, with millions distributed annually. Basic research may be supported when aligned with the foundation's field of operation. The application period opens August 15 and closes September 30 each year, with decisions made in early December by Neurofonden's board based on recommendations from Neuroförbundet's advisory research committee.
